Some 200 people attended the community seder held by Chabad of South Broward in Hallandale Beach, FL, on both nights of Pesach.
Besides for inspiring words and a delicious menu, participants enjoyed a rendition of “Ana Hashem” from the Hallel prayer by Sinai, a 93 year-old Holocaust survivor hailing pre-war Lodz, Poland.
On chol hamoed, Sinai was back to daven at Chabad when he played for congregants the song of Dayenu on his harmonica.
The seders were held in addition to the distribution of Shmurah Matzos to over 300 families, and providing Pesach food and money to over 50 families.
